Kinds Of Water Therapy Chemicals
Water treatment chemicals can be found in numerous kinds, each serving a particular function in making certain water top quality (water treatment chemicals kingwood texas). You'll run into coagulants, which assist eliminate put on hold bits, making water more clear and safer. Flocculants function along with coagulants to bind these fragments with each other for much easier elimination. Disinfectants, like chlorine and ozone, eliminate harmful bacteria, guaranteeing your water is risk-free to consume.
Softening agents reduce solidity, making water more appropriate for family and industrial usages. By understanding these kinds, you can make enlightened decisions about which chemicals are best for your particular water treatment needs.

Application Specificity Importance
Choosing the right water treatment chemical is fundamental for achieving effective results, as each chemical is made for particular applications. For example, chlorine is wonderful for sanitation, while coagulants like aluminum sulfate master removing put on hold particles. If you require to regulate pH degrees, utilizing acids or bases customized for water treatment is imperative.
It's important to evaluate your water top quality and therapy objectives before choosing a chemical. By focusing on application uniqueness, you assure that the chemicals you use job properly, leading to much safer and cleaner water.

Governing Compliance and Standards
Regulative conformity is crucial in the water treatment chemicals sector, as it assures the safety and efficiency of items you utilize. Acquainting yourself with guidelines set by firms like the Environmental Protection Firm (EPA) and the Food and Medication Administration (FDA) is important. These standards make certain that the chemicals satisfy security standards and are appropriate for your details applications.
You'll need to stay on par with local, state, and government laws, which can differ. Recognizing labeling needs is additionally vital, as this notifies you about appropriate use and security preventative measures. Furthermore, suppliers must provide safety information sheets (SDS) that detail dangers and dealing with guidelines.

Exactly how Do I Store Water Treatment Chemicals Safely?
To keep water therapy chemicals safely, keep them in original containers, label them clearly, and shop in a great, completely dry area away from direct sunlight. Always guarantee they're out of reach of animals and children.
Can I Mix Different Water Treatment Chemicals?
You should not blend various water treatment chemicals without understanding their compatibility. Incorporating them can create harmful reactions or minimize performance. Always inspect tags and speak with a professional before trying to mix any type of chemicals for safety and security.
When Utilizing These Chemicals?, what Personal Protective Equipment Is Needed.
When making use of water therapy chemicals, you need to wear gloves, goggles, and a mask. These secure you from skin irritability, eye damage, and breathing concerns. Always guarantee correct air flow in your work area to stay secure.
How Do Temperature and Ph Impact Chemical Efficiency?
Temperature and pH significantly influence chemical effectiveness. You'll locate that greater temperatures commonly increase response prices, while pH degrees my company can boost or prevent the task of specific chemicals, so keeping an eye on these variables is important for best results.
What Are the Indicators of Chemical Overuse in Water Therapy?
You'll notice indications of chemical overuse in water treatment with unpleasant smells, over cast water, and unusual color modifications. In addition, fish or plant distress reveals that chemical degrees may be also high for a healthy community.
